>From Tom at the discord channel

* Yeah, you can see from the code coverage report [1] that
session_username() isn't reached in our tests. It's only used if the psql
prompt string is set to use it, and testing that in an interesting way is
kind of hard --- our standard regression-script framework doesn't expose
prompt output. On balance I'm not sure that covering session_username()
would be worth the test cycles. [1]
https://coverage.postgresql.org/src/bin/psql/common.c.gcov.html
<https://coverage.postgresql.org/src/bin/psql/common.c.gcov.html>*

So, yes I don't think we can auto-test it really, thus we'll have to rely
on these simple functional tests.
